Joshua May is a graduate of the University of Massachusetts-Boston and has managed businesses in the technology, hospitality and renewable energy sectors. In each of his ventures Joshua has forged strategic marketing relationships at the grass roots level as well as with fortune 500 companies, government agencies and top-level professional sports organizations. He has been an entrepreneur and leader in the Renewable Energy/Sustainability sector since 2005. From 2005 to 2008 he helped to launch and expand the first solar company to enter the residential leasing sector. Joshua then moved on to business development leadership roles in the electric car charging station market, and then on to the exploding commercial LED retrofit industry.
Since 2010 Joshua has served as a Regional Vice-President and now a partnering associate for Energy Saving Solutions. In 2014-2015 he will be completing professional development courses at MIT. Upon completion, Joshua will be LEED AP O+M and LEED AP BD+C certified, as well as attain the BEAP and CEM designations. He is a member of the Massachusetts Chapter of USGBC. Joshua resides in Massachusetts where he is updating his consulting credentials and is heavily involved in many community outreach programs and environmentally focused causes.
